Acquia DXP - Product Overview
Primary Function
Acquia DXP is designed to integrate various technologies such as content management, data management, personalization, and analytics. Its main function is to deliver consistent and personalized digital experiences, helping businesses engage customers more effectively through websites, mobile apps, and other digital touchpoints.
Target Audience
The platform is targeted at developers, marketers, and IT teams within organizations. It facilitates collaboration and improves agility across these teams, making it a valuable tool for enterprise-level businesses looking to enhance their digital presence.
Key Features
Governed Content and Assets
Acquia DXP allows businesses to leverage Drupal models and content types, create page templates and design systems, and manage omnichannel digital assets. It also provides a 360° view of products and manages product information and marketing copy.
Intelligent Customer Data
The platform unifies customer data through over 300 integrations and uses Identity Resolution to create a 360° customer view. It enables rule-based segmentation and channels for campaign orchestration and feeds data to downstream systems. This helps in activating omnichannel campaigns through various channels like landing pages, email, SMS, and social media.
Predictive Marketing
Acquia DXP creates dynamic and personalized content using out-of-the-box and custom machine learning (ML) models. It automates actionable insights and utilizes next best step/next best action strategies. The platform also uses dynamic audience segmentation to scale campaigns.

AI Assistants & Automation
Acquia’s Open DXP incorporates AI assistants and automation tools to streamline various processes. For instance, AI can automate content creation, metadata tagging, and asset classification using generative AI and computer vision. This includes auto-tagging assets, generating asset descriptions and alt tags, and finding similar images based on color and look, which significantly reduces manual tasks and speeds up the content creation process.
Machine Learning Studio
The Machine Learning Studio within Acquia DXP enables businesses to drive personalized experiences by leveraging collateral metadata and powerful out-of-the-box machine learning models. This includes ML-powered customer segmentation and automated cross-channel activation, allowing for more targeted and effective marketing campaigns.

AI-Powered Content Workflows
Acquia’s AI-powered features, such as the Acquia Video Creator, streamline content workflows by allowing users to produce videos using a drag-and-drop interface, existing assets, and customizable templates. AI generates scripts, voiceovers, subtitles, transcripts, and translations, making video creation more cost-effective and accessible. Additionally, AI-powered video transcription and automated color filtering enhance the accessibility and manageability of digital assets.

Acquia DXP - Pricing and Plans
Acquia CDP (Customer Data Platform)
- Acquia CDP offers three main pricing plans: Standard, Premium, and Enterprise.
- Standard: Includes features like Machine Learning Powered Identity Resolution, GDPR/CCPA compliance, and Unlimited Configurable Reporting. Additional features such as Multitouch Attribution, Multibrand/Region, Third Party Data Support, Snowflake Data Sharing, and Custom IRE Rules are available as add-ons.
- Premium: Builds on the Standard plan with the same core features, and some add-ons like Custom IRE Rules are included. Other add-ons like ML Studio Application are still available separately.
- Enterprise: This tier includes all the features from the Premium plan and may have more comprehensive support and additional advanced features, though specific details are not fully outlined in the provided sources.
Acquia DAM (Digital Asset Management)
- Acquia DAM has several pricing plans:
- Workgroup: Designed for departments to centralize assets and maximize impact. Features include Personalized Dashboards, Simple to configure metadata, Powerful search, Flexible roles and permissions, AI-powered metadata and visual search, and more.
- Enterprise: Focuses on driving efficiency and consistency across business units. It includes all the features from the Workgroup plan plus additional capabilities like Product data modeling, Related assets by product, and Channel distribution.
- DAM PIM: This plan manages product data, feature lists, and other product content, combining the features of DAM and Product Information Management (PIM).
- Free Trial: Acquia offers a free trial for Acquia DAM, allowing 50 free user seats and access to customer support and resources.
Acquia Cloud Platform
- This platform is focused on hosting and managing Drupal applications and does not directly fall under analytics tools but is part of the broader DXP.
- Standard, Plus, Premium, Elite: These tiers vary in features such as File Storage, DB Storage, Included Drupal Applications, Cloud CD Dev Environments, Acquia Search, and support levels. Additional features like Enterprise Security Package, Team TAM, and 99.99% Uptime SLA are available as add-ons in higher tiers.

Acquia DXP - Customer Support and Resources
Acquia DXP Customer Support
Customer Support
- 24/7 Critical Support: For urgent issues, Acquia Support is available 24/7 to ensure uninterrupted care. This support includes direct access to a large network of professionals with over 300 years of combined expertise in Drupal and other DXP products.
- Non-Critical Support: For non-critical issues, support is available during business hours within the designated support region. Customers can submit requests through Acquia’s online ticket management system or by phone during specified hours.
- Advisory Services: Some Acquia subscriptions include Customer Advisory hours, which allow customers to engage with Acquia experts for discussions on best practices, implementation, tuning, and achieving business outcomes. These advisory sessions can be scheduled through the ticket portal and are limited to specific topics such as security best practices, module selection advice, and performance best practices.
Additional Resources
- Acquia Help Center: This resource provides technical documentation, videos, whitepapers, and training and webinar information to help customers use Acquia products effectively. It is a valuable starting point for researching non-critical issues and finding troubleshooting tips, best practices, and solutions to known issues.
- Support Portal: The Support Portal is where customers can submit issues to Acquia Support. It also allows for direct communication via conference calls or meetings to address specific issues or clarify recommendations. Customers can request read-only access to their environment for diagnostic support, and in some cases, Acquia Support may make changes with the customer’s authorization.
- Expertise Across Products: Acquia Support includes expertise in various areas such as Drupal core, contributed modules and themes, Customer Data Platform (CDP), Campaign Studio, and Digital Asset Management (DAM). This ensures that customers receive comprehensive support across all aspects of their digital technology suite.
